Ubuntu18.04 安装mysql5.7

离线安装

1. 系统环境

系统:ubuntu-18.04.6-live-server-amd64

数据库:mysql-server_5.7.42

2. 下载依赖

  • libmecab2_0.996-5_amd64.deb
  • libaio1_0.3.110-5_amd64.deb
  • libc6_2.27-3ubuntu1_amd64.deb

依赖包下载

1. 可以在下面地址中搜索依赖包的位置

https://pkgs.org/search/?q=libgomp1https://pkgs.org/search/?q=libgomp1

 点击需要的依赖包名称,然后拖拽到下面Download位置查看下载地址,然后把地址复制粘贴到浏览器地址栏中,就开始下载依赖包了。如下:

 或者根据下载路劲中的路劲结构使用下面 2 的位置的URL中,进行查找,下载对应的版本依赖包。

2. 按照查询出来的位置在下面的页面进行下载。

Index of /ubuntu/pool/mainhttp://archive.ubuntu.com/ubuntu/pool/main/注:也可以在第一步骤中找到下载路劲进行直接下载。

3. 下载数据库安装包

  • mysql-server_5.7.42-1ubuntu18.04_amd64.deb-bundle.tar

4. 安装依赖

sudo dpkg -i libmecab2_0.996-5_amd64.deb
sudo dpkg -i libaio1_0.3.110-5_amd64.deb
sudo dpkg -i libc6_2.27-3ubuntu1_amd64.deb

5. 解压mysql数据库安装包

#解压mysql安装包
sudo tar -xvf mysql-server_5.7.42-1ubuntu18.04_amd64.deb-bundle.tar
# 查询解压后数据
ll
# 结果
libmysqlclient20_5.7.42-lubuntu13.04_amd64.deb
libmysqlclient-dev_5.7.42-1ubuntul3.04_amd64.deb
libmysqld-dev_5.7.42-1ubuntul8.04_amd64.deb
mysql-client_5.7.42-lubuntu18.04_amd64.deb
mysql-common_5.7.42-1ubuntu18.04_amd64.deb
mysql-community-client_5.7.42-lubuntul3.04_amd64.deb
mysql-community-server_5.7.42-1ubuntu18.04_amd64.deb
mysql-community-source_5.7.42-lubuntu18.04_amd64.deb
mysql-community-test_5.7.42-lubuntu18.04_amd64.deb
mysql-server_5.7.42-1ubuntu18.04_amd64.deb
mysql-testsuite_5.7.42-1ubuntu18.04_amd64.deb

6. 安装mysql

按照顺序安装MySQL文件

sudo dpkg -i mysql-common_5.7.42-1ubuntu18.04_amd64.deb
# 此步需要输入数据库的root账号的密码
sudo dpkg-preconfigure mysql-community-server_5.7.42-1ubuntu18.04_amd64.deb
sudo dpkg -i libmysqlclient20_5.7.42-lubuntu13.04_amd64.deb
sudo dpkg -i libmysqlclient-dev_5.7.42-1ubuntul3.04_amd64.deb
sudo dpkg -i libmysqld-dev_5.7.42-1ubuntul8.04_amd64.deb
sudo dpkg -i mysql-community-client_5.7.42-lubuntul3.04_amd64.deb
sudo dpkg -i mysql-client_5.7.42-lubuntu18.04_amd64.deb
sudo dpkg -i mysql-common_5.7.42-1ubuntu18.04_amd64.deb
sudo dpkg -i mysql-community-source_5.7.42-lubuntu18.04_amd64.deb
sudo dpkg -i mysql-community-server_5.7.42-1ubuntu18.04_amd64.deb
sudo dpkg -i mysql-server_5.7.42-1ubuntu18.04_amd64.deb

7. 检查mysql安装是否成功

mysql -u root -p

8. 修改MySQL 配置


修改mysql配置文件:mysqld.cnf   

sudo vi /etc/mysql/mysql.conf.d/mysqld.cnf

修改 bind-address = 0.0.0.0
service mysql restart

9. 修改数据库root配置

#链接数据库,输入密码
mysql -u root -p  
# 使用数据库,访问mysql库
use mysql         
# 修改用户表配置      
update user set host = '%' where user = 'root';
# 刷新执行结果
flush privileges;

10. 离线安装完成

评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值